Reverse-Polish-Notation:逆波兰表示法 - 包括对数字、字符串和函数表达式的支持

时间:2024-07-12 23:31:09
【文件属性】:

文件名称:Reverse-Polish-Notation:逆波兰表示法 - 包括对数字、字符串和函数表达式的支持

文件大小:15KB

文件格式:ZIP

更新时间:2024-07-12 23:31:09

HTML

rpn - 反向波兰符号 PHP 类 这个 PHP 类实现了一个逆波兰表示法 (RPN) 评估,它支持数字、字符串和用户定义的函数以及用于数字/字符串操作的内置 PHP 函数。 #####Live 示例和其他项目可以在我的 [development] ( ) 站点上找到。 一些例子: 1. 数字示例: 表达式: 5 + ((1 + 2) * 4) − 3 ######RPN 表示: 5 1 2 + 4 * + 3 - 本例的结果为14 ,计算方式如下: 1+2 = 3 3*4 = 12 12+5 = 17 17-3 = 14 require_once('nsfRPN.php'); $rpn = new RPN(); $res = $rpn->rpn("5 + ((1 + 2) * 4) - 3"); 2. 'date' 和 'strtotime' 函数示例: 表达式


【文件预览】:
Reverse-Polish-Notation-master
----liverpn.php(2KB)
----README.md(5KB)
----liverpn.js(2KB)
----nsfRPN.php(16KB)
----index.html(47KB)

网友评论